Sebastian Meijer (born September 1, 1984) is a Swedish professional ice hockey winger who currently plays for Malmö Redhawks of the HockeyAllsvenskan (Swe-1). He has played six seasons in the Swedish top-tier league Elitserien (SEL), as well as six seasons in the second-tier league HockeyAllsvenskan (Swe-1). Internationally Meijer represented the Swedish junior national team at the 2004 World Junior Ice Hockey Championships.
